IntroductIon Finding appropriate decision support systems (DSS) development processes and methodologies is a topic that has kept researchers in the decision support community busy for the past three decades at least. Inspired by Gibson and Nolan's curve (Gibson & Nolan 1974; Nolan, 1979), it is fair BLOCKINto BLOCKINcontend BLOCKINthat BLOCKINthe BLOCKINfield BLOCKINof BLOCKINDSS BLOCKINdevelopment is reaching the end of its expansion (or contagion) stage, which is characterized by the proliferation of processes and methodologies in all areas of decision support. Studies on DSS development conducted during the last 15 years BLOCKINhave BLOCKINidentified BLOCKINmore BLOCKINthan BLOCKIN30 different approaches to the design and construction of decision support methods and systems (Marakas, 2003). Interestingly enough, none of these approaches predominate and the various DSS development processes usually remain very BLOCKINdistinct BLOCKINand BLOCKINproject-specific. BLOCKINThis BLOCKINsituation can BLOCKINbe BLOCKINinterpreted BLOCKINas BLOCKINa BLOCKINsign BLOCKINthat BLOCKINthe BLOCKINfield BLOCKINof BLOCKINDSS development should soon enter in its formaliza-tion (or control) stage. Therefore, we propose a unifying perspective of DSS development based on the notion of context. In this article, we argue that the context of the target DSS (whether organizational, technological, or developmental) is not properly considered in the literature on DSS development. Researchers propose processes (e. for end-user computer), and frameworks, but often fail to explicitly describe the context in which the solution can be applied.
